- [ ] **Step 7: Breaker override escrow.** After sealing the signing keys for the Tallgrove upstream API circuit breaker, confirm the support team can force the breaker open during a full outage. The override bundle lives in the sealed escrow drawer and is useless without its unlock phrase. Two ceremony witnesses must initial this step before proceeding. The escrow bundle is decrypted with the recovery passphrase that follows.

vault phrase of kahip-kahop = holath-quenmir

Subject: Template rendering — ownership change

Effective Monday, responsibility for Fernwhistle template rendering performance moves off my plate. The p95 regression work, the cache-warming experiments, and the render-budget dashboard all transfer. Open items are tagged `tmpl-perf` in the tracker. For the upcoming release, route all rendering questions to the new owner named below.

approver of yawig-yajef = Briius Jorix

Subject: Quickstore 4.2 — bloom filter now fronts the KV layer

Plugin authors: starting with this release, Quickstore places a bloom filter ahead of the key-value store. Negative lookups return faster; false positives fall through safely. No API changes are required on your side. Verify your plugin against the staging build referenced below.

session token of fahif-tadup = htk3_9c7

Changed defaults in Splitfork, our assignment service. Bucketing now uses sticky hashing per account instead of per session, and the holdout slice grew from 2% to 5%. Callers relying on session-level reassignment must opt in explicitly. Review the diff against the new baseline; the updated default configuration is listed below.

config for tagep-kajof:
[casir]
port = 6379
region = south-1
host = casir.paliqdyn.example
team = tamax
timeout_ms = 250
retries = 2